Annemarie Smith, age 79, passed away Monday morning, Jan 15th, 2007, at Mercy Medical Center in Oshkosh. Annemarie was born Dec 10th, 1927 in Leipzig, Germany, the daughter of Karl & Maria (Haase) Todt. On November 6, 1954, she married Willard Smith, an American civilian working for the Dept. of Defense in Stuttgart, Germany. The couple then moved to the States. Annemarie was a determined, highly intelligent woman. She took a keen interest in political affairs, was an avid bridge and cribbage player, and derived particular enjoyment from classical music, languages, and memorizing poetry. In addition to her native German, she was fluent in English and French and started learning Latin in her late 60s. She memorized and could recite over 100 poems (some lengthy epics!), as well as the classic French book, The Little Prince. In the late 1960s, Annemarie was diagnosed with Multiple Sclerosis and was given a life expectancy of 5-10 years. She consistently defied medical predictions over the years, surviving many life-threatening conditions until her final battle with cancer. Her last 14 years were spent at Bethel Lutheran Homes in Oshkosh, where she made several lasting friendships among the staff.
